How to choose: Are you explaining a sequence of effects, or a result produced jointly by multiple causes?
Core distinction
Use CLF059 for a causal chain where Y is an intermediate mechanism between X and Z. Use CLF060 when Y and Z are parallel contributing factors that jointly produce X; neither is merely an intermediate step in the other.
First pattern · CLF059
[X] leads to [Y], which in turn leads to [Z].
Express a multi-step causal chain and make the intermediate mechanism visible.
Formula: [X] leads to [Y], which in turn leads to [Z].
Example: Missing ownership leads to slower decisions, which in turn leads to longer incident resolution.
CLF060
Formula: [X] results from a combination of [Y] and [Z].
Example: The incident results from a combination of stale mapping and missing validation.

Best-fit pattern: CLF059 · [X] leads to [Y], which in turn leads to [Z].
Why it fits: Choose CLF059 because the outcome unfolds as a causal sequence: X affects Y, and Y then affects Z.
Why not the nearby pattern: CLF060 would treat two factors as parallel contributors to one outcome. Here the second effect is produced through the first effect instead.

Best-fit pattern: CLF060 · [X] results from a combination of [Y] and [Z].
Why it fits: Choose CLF060 because two parallel contributing factors jointly explain one outcome.
Why not the nearby pattern: CLF059 would impose a sequence in which one cause produces an intermediate effect that then produces the final outcome. That mechanism is not present here.
